WebNov 25, 2024 · What is BIRCH? Data Mining Database Data Structure. BIRCH represents Balanced Iterative Reducing and Clustering Using Hierarchies. It is designed for clustering a huge amount of numerical records by integration of hierarchical clustering and other clustering methods including iterative partitioning. WebBIRCH Algorithm Phases The primary phases of BIRCH are: Phase 1: – BIRCH scans the database to build an initial in-memory CF tree Phase 2: Hierarchical Methods – BIRCH applies a (selected) clustering algorithm to cluster the leaf nodes of the CF tree, which removes sparse clusters as outliers and groups dense clusters into larger ones. WebBIRCH (balanced iterative reducing and clustering using hierarchies) is an unsupervised data mining algorithm used to perform hierarchical clustering over particularly large data-sets. An advantage of BIRCH is its ability to incrementally and dynamically cluster incoming, multi-dimensional metric data points in an attempt to produce the best quality clustering …
